The EMPD Specialized Services, comprising of Community Liaison and Public Order Policing Units, arrested three suspected drug dealers on Commissioner Street in Boksburg on Wednesday, July 17 for possession of crystal methamphetamine and khat valued at over R5 000.
According to chief superintendent Wilfred Kgasago, EMPD spokesperson, the arrest took place at 10am at the intersection of Bank and Commissioner streets in the Boksburg CBD.
“The trio was found in possession of a plastic bag containing khat in block form estimated at R4 000 and 10 ziplocks of crystal meth with the street value of R1 000,” said Kgasago.
The arrested trio aged 25, 32 and 43 was detained at Boksburg Central police station charged with possession and dealing in narcotics.
